Seared Salmon with Steamed Asparagus and Brown Rice

INGREDIENTS
5 oz Salmon Fillet (142g)
0.75 cup cooked Brown Rice (150g)
1 cup Asparagus (134g)
1 tsp Olive Oil
1 tbsp Lemon Juice
Pinch of Salt
Pinch of Black Pepper
PREPARATION
Pat the salmon fillet dry with a paper towel. Season both sides with a pinch of salt and black pepper.
Heat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at and add the olive oil. Once shimmering, place the salmon skin-side down (if applicable) and sear for about 3-4 minutes until a golden crust forms.
Flip the salmon carefully and reduce heat slightly. Cook for an additional 3-4 minutes until the salmon is just cooked through but still moist in the center.
While the salmon is cooking, bring a small pot of water to a simmer and add the asparagus. Steam the asparagus for about 4-5 minutes until tender but still crisp.
Reheat the pre-cooked brown rice if needed in a microwave or on the stove until warmed through.
Drizzle lemon juice over the seared salmon once off the heat for a burst of freshness.
Plate the salmon alongside the brown rice and steamed asparagus. Serve warm and enjoy this balanced, flavorful dinner.
